TACMAP tab in the paused menu
Clearly this reinforces the fact the ring is “open-world.” In quotations bc some parts are likely quest locked for later. This is also supported by the advert on Infinite’s official page, saying “A Ring to Explore. Explore the epic expanse of a Halo ring for the first time in the most ambitious Halo game ever made.” On the bottom of the menu you can also see the ability to set waypoints and view missions. And when a waypoint was hovered over there looked to be rewards and difficulty assigned to it. I’m also guessing that we’ll have different vehicle choices in the later parts of the campaign. Another curious thought is that open-world games also usually incorporate some kind of checkpoint hub like a new town or somewhere you can return to, a place to find “quest givers”. I wonder if something like that will appear here, since it seems you may be searching for survivors like in CE in the beginning parts of the game. Grappling Hook
I really dig this mechanic, both in exploratory ability (yay verticality!) and uses in battle. I wonder what sets the limit of you pulling something to you or you launching to it? This is totally fresh and new for Halo and I’m excited to see how it’s used and to experiment with it. It also makes me wonder how 343 planned their map design in regards to it’s ability. (Imagine if you could explore the terrain like in Horizon Zero Dawn). Also, it seems to be a permanent attachment in campaign? Or maybe you have to acquire it. Either way, it had a charge so it can’t be spammed, that’s nice. But it looks like if you pick up equipment it overrides your hook slot so it’s one or the other I guess.

Equipment
Yay! Return of pick-up-able equipments! I loved this from Halo 3, it added a very unique dynamic in both campaign and multiplayer. And did you see the size of the deployable shield wall!? Looked like you could shoot through as well. I’m excited to see what others there are and different tricks you can use with them. So then thinking about the controller - RB is assigned to equipment/grapple, LB is frag rotation most likely but I don’t think I saw it pop on screen, RT is shoot, LT is grenade throw, sticks are likely Sprint and Zoom, and your standard assignments to A,B,X,Y. No duel wielding it seems. Be cool if the D-Pad could be used and have different equipment assigned to it.

Advanced Movement
Sprint confirmed for campaign at least. Clamber and slide were seen. Grappling hook is a whole new element. But it doesn’t look like Thrust was a thing and I don’t imagine that would be equipment unless it came with more than one use? It will be interesting to see how this and equipment is used in MP.
